Review

Meadowlark Assisted Living is best suited for families seeking a warm, home-like environment where residents are treated with genuine kindness and care feels more like a family affair than institutional living. The community earns praise for a culture of compassion, with staff described as patient, friendly, and genuinely engaged in residents’ lives. Families consistently note a welcoming atmosphere, owners and caregivers who invest in relationships, and a sense that residents are “part of the family.” This setting works well for seniors who want meaningful social interaction, regular interaction with staff, and reassurance that care is delivered with personal warmth in a familiar, intimate environment.

The strongest positives center on the caregiving culture. Staff are described as truly kind and compassionate, going beyond routine tasks to foster friendship and trust with both residents and their families. Several reviews highlight the feeling of a supportive, family-oriented team that treats residents like cherished members of the household. The ability to visit with a resident’s own dog is a tangible example of how the community embraces personal comforts and familiar routines. That level of relational care can offset many day-to-day bumps for families who prioritize emotional well-being and social connectedness over clinical minutiae.

Yet several reviews introduce meaningful caveats that potential residents should weigh. One star signals a serious concern about safety and staffing that cannot be dismissed: claims of unsafe conditions, drug presence, and a lack of staff oversight. While this is an outlier in the overall pattern, it signals that some experiences at Meadowlark have fallen short of expectations and warrants careful verification during a tour. Another critical report paints a picture of inconsistent daily support, suggesting delays in meals or personal care, with accusations of staff being unresponsive or disengaged at times. Taken together, these accounts imply that reliability and supervision can vary, and are therefore worth inspecting firsthand.

In daily life, the environment is described as beautiful, with a true sense of “home.” The atmosphere fosters belonging and reduces the isolation that often accompanies aging, which is a strong offset to the more routine care provided elsewhere. However, practical realities appear alongside the warmth: a resident notes repetitive meals during the week with some variation on weekends, which can affect satisfaction for long-term residents who rely on predictable nutrition. Other tangible care gaps cited include inconsistent morning routines and, in at least one account, concerns about timely baths or pendant-call responsiveness. These gaps, while not universal, underline the reality that care quality is not perfectly uniform across all shifts and days.

Prospective families who are evaluating Meadowlark should be mindful of who may want to consider alternatives. The strongest caveat is for residents who require steady, high-level clinical oversight, strict safety protocols, or specialized memory care with predictable staffing patterns. For these individuals, the combination of a warm, personal culture and the variability in staffing responsiveness may not meet the level of clinical rigor expected in a higher-acuity setting. Those prioritizing consistently proactive medical management, near-constant supervision, or a robust structured program should compare Meadowlark with other communities that emphasize on-site nursing, clear escalation procedures, and dedicated memory care units.

The bottom-line recommendation is practical and decisive. Meadowlark delivers a compelling blend of warmth, family-like care, and social vitality that can make life easier for seniors who value companionship and a sense of belonging over formalized clinical intensity. It is a strong choice for families seeking a nurturing, low-stress environment where staff feel like extended family and residents feel valued. For families where safety, consistent clinical oversight, and unambiguous daily performance are non-negotiable, it is essential to explore alternatives, question staffing reliability, and verify care routines in person. A targeted tour, focused on staffing patterns, daily schedules, meal options, and the handling of emergencies, will reveal whether Meadowlark’s heart aligns with the resident’s needs or if a more medically oriented setting is a better fit.

Description

Meadowlark Assisted Living Facility in Great Falls, MT is a welcoming community that offers Independent Living for seniors looking for a comfortable and supportive environment. Our residents can enjoy their own fully furnished apartment with amenities such as cable or satellite TV, Wi-Fi/high-speed internet, housekeeping services, and a small library.

We understand the importance of delicious and nutritious meals, which is why our dining room offers restaurant-style dining with special dietary restrictions taken into consideration. Our residents are also welcomed to use the kitchenette in their apartment if they prefer to prepare their own meals.

At Meadowlark Assisted Living Facility, we prioritize the well-being of our residents. With 24-hour supervision and assistance available, our staff is trained to provide support with activities of daily living, bathing, dressing, transfers, medication management, and diabetes diet. We also have a mental wellness program in place to ensure the emotional health of our residents.

Our community encourages an active lifestyle by offering resident-run activities and scheduled daily activities for everyone to enjoy. Additionally, Meadowlark is conveniently located near various amenities including cafes, parks, pharmacies, physicians' offices, restaurants, places of worship, transportation options, and hospitals.
